Lol there's nothing wrong with having a weaker build. I'm 13 myself, so...yeah.

 

If you can, try another monitor. If not, I'd just say it's a dying video card. Try running stress tests like Furmark and Unigine Heaven on your GPU and see if it happens then (be sure to monitor temps).
